Late-Night Hosts Join Forces in New Podcast ‘Strike Force Five’ Amid Hollywood’s Strike Impasse

by time news

Late-night talk show hosts Stephen Colbert, Jimmy Fallon, Jimmy Kimmel, John Oliver, and Seth Meyers have joined forces for a new podcast called “Strike Force Five.” The hosts, who are known for their comedic talents and popular shows, have united to support the striking writers in Hollywood.

The podcast, which debuted at the top of Spotify and Apple’s podcast charts, aims to raise money for personnel impacted by the strike, including writers and other TV show members who are currently out of work. In the first episode of the podcast, the hosts expressed their hope that the strike would end soon, with Colbert humorously comparing the situation to a colonoscopy rather than a vacation.
